Energy Efficiency Advantages and Drawbacks
You’ll appreciate how the prefab container house leverages tempered glass and alloy steel to enhance insulation, reducing energy loss considerably.
However, the metal structure can also conduct heat, potentially increasing cooling demands in warmer climates.

Step-By-Step Modular Assembly Guide
Leveraging the combined strength of alloy steel and tempered glass, assembling your prefab container house follows a systematic modular approach designed for efficiency and accuracy.
You begin by aligning base modules on a leveled surface, ensuring structural integrity. Next, attach wall panels with pre-fitted tempered glass, optimizing assembly efficiency through precise locking mechanisms.
Integrate electrical and plumbing conduits within designated channels before sealing joints for durability. Finally, install sliding doors and roof panels, completing the modular design seamlessly.
